CBE=Clear blue easy OPK's Chat Icon

When you look at an OPK the test line HAS to be as dark or even better-darker than the control line to tell you are surging. Then after you get that surge you will prob o anywhere from 4-36 hours after that.

Are you charting your temps or just using OPK's?

If you chart your temps you will get to know a pattern and you will know when to use the opk's along with temps and cervical fluid to tell you when you are o'ing.
